Planning Thoughtfully: Integrating Green Marble Pattern for Background

Before implementing the Green Marble Pattern for Background, consider the purpose of the design and the audience it will serve. For example, if your project is targeting professionals in finance or corporate sectors, the pattern should be subtle and not distract from key data points. Conversely, for creative industries like fashion or art, a more decorative and abstract approach may be appropriate.

Here are some strategic planning tips for using this pattern effectively:

  1. Define the Tone: Is your message formal, playful, or luxurious? Choose the intensity and style of the marble pattern accordingly.
  2. Contrast Matters: Ensure the text or images layered over the pattern maintain readability. Opt for lighter or darker overlays based on the pattern’s brightness.
  3. Test Across Devices: Because the ZIP folder includes various resolutions and file types, test the pattern on different screens and platforms to ensure consistent quality.
  4. Stay Consistent: Use the same pattern across related designs (e.g., website headers, email templates, social media covers) to reinforce brand identity and cohesion.

Why the Green Marble Pattern Stands Out

The uniqueness of the Green Marble Pattern for Background lies in its balance between natural inspiration and modern design sensibilities. Unlike generic stock patterns, it provides a rich texture that feels both timeless and contemporary. Its use of gradients—often transitioning between turquoise and deep green—creates a sense of depth and motion, ideal for backgrounds that need to feel alive but not chaotic.

This pattern works especially well in environments where visual hierarchy is important. By using it as a base, you can build upon it with contrasting colors, bold typography, or illustrative elements. For instance, a blog cover using this pattern could feature a white serif font to emphasize clarity and professionalism, or a dark sans-serif font for a more modern, edgy look.
